▶️ Security Alert on CVE-2014-0160 (Heartbleed Vulnerability)

Oracle has issued an important security alert addressing the critical vulnerability CVE-2014-0160, widely known as Heartbleed. This flaw affects OpenSSL implementations used in various Oracle products and infrastructure devices. Heartbleed enables attackers to read sensitive memory contents from vulnerable systems, potentially exposing private keys, passwords, and other confidential data.

  • Data centers and cloud infrastructure running Oracle appliances or software that leverage OpenSSL are at risk.
  • Immediate patching and updates are essential to mitigate unauthorized data disclosure.
  • Administrators must verify their Oracle products for vulnerability status and apply the Oracle-provided patches promptly.
